Note: As of Reaction 2.0 the CLI is deprecated and unsupported. You can use the Docker commands listed in this doc, to achieve the same results.
This document lists some handy commands to use while developing on Reaction.
grep version package.json to check what version of Reaction you are currently running.
> grep version package.json "version": "2.0.0-rc.10", "last 2 versions"
To run the server integration tests:
docker-compose run --rm reaction npm run test
To run the tests for a specific file use the following commands. Replace
file with the name of the file you want to test.
docker-compose run --rm reaction npm run test:file
Use the following command to lint your local files. This ensures you are running the same version of Reaction's ESLint.
docker-compose run --rm reaction npm run lint
Debug Server Code
To learn more on how to set up the inspector, check out our debugging documentation.
Tun Reaction without the default sample data store and products:
.envand add the following variable:
- Restart Reaction with